Native & Cross Platform
Choosing between native and cross-platform mobile development is a significant decision when developing a mobile app. Both approaches have their advantages and limitations. In this blog post, we’ll explore the key considerations to help you decide whether to go with native or cross-platform mobile development.
Native Mobile Development:
Pros:
Performance: Native apps are typically faster and more responsive because they are optimized for the specific platform (iOS or Android).
They have direct access to device features and APIs.
User Experience: Native apps offer a seamless and consistent user experience that adheres to the platform’s design guidelines (Material Design for Android, Human Interface Guidelines for iOS).
Access to Hardware: Native apps have full access to the device’s hardware features, such as the camera, GPS, and sensors, which can be crucial for certain app functionalities.
App Store Optimization: Native apps can take full advantage of platform-specific app stores (Apple App Store and Google Play Store) for better visibility and discoverability.
Security: Native development allows for more robust security measures to protect user data.
Cons:
Development Time and Cost: Developing separate native apps for iOS and Android requires more time and resources.
Skill Requirements: You need developers with platform-specific skills (Swift/Objective-C for iOS and Java/Kotlin for Android).
Cross-Platform Mobile Development:
Pros:
Code Reusability: Cross-platform frameworks (e.g., React Native, Flutter, Xamarin) allow you to write code once and deploy it on multiple platforms, reducing development time and cost.
Faster Development: Cross-platform development can be faster because you don’t need to build and maintain two separate codebases.
Large Community: Cross-platform frameworks often have active communities, providing access to pre-built components and libraries.
Consistency: Cross-platform apps can maintain a consistent look and feel across different platforms.
Cons:
Performance: Cross-platform apps may not match the performance of native apps, especially for highly graphic-intensive or complex applications.
Platform Limitations: Access to device-specific features and APIs may be limited, leading to compromises in functionality.
Tool and Framework Dependencies: You may be dependent on the updates and support of the cross-platform framework you choose.
Debugging Challenges: Debugging and fixing issues can be more complex in cross-platform development due to abstraction layers.
Choosing Between Native and Cross-Platform
The decision between native and cross-platform development depends on your project’s specific requirements and constraints. Here are some factors to consider:
App Complexity: For simple apps, cross-platform development may be a cost-effective choice. However, for complex and performance-critical apps, native development is often recommended.
Development Timeline: If you need to release your app quickly on multiple platforms, cross-platform development can save time.
Budget: Consider your budget and resource constraints. Cross-platform development can be more cost-effective, but native development provides a premium experience.
Target Audience: If your audience is predominantly on a single platform (iOS or Android), consider starting with the native app for that platform.
Long-Term Maintenance: Think about long-term maintenance and updates. Native apps may require more ongoing effort and cost.
In conclusion, the choice between native and cross-platform mobile development depends on a careful evaluation of your project’s specific needs, resources, and goals. There’s no one-size-fits-all answer, and what’s best for one project may not be ideal for another. Careful consideration and a clear understanding of your app’s requirements will guide you toward the right development approach.
